[Detailed Description of the Invention] The present invention relates to a ventilation fan for ducts, and an object of the present invention is to facilitate maintenance work such as inspection and repair thereof, and to maintain good airtightness at the connection between the ventilation fan body and the duct. It is something to do.

The conventional duct ventilation fan, as shown in Figure 1,
When performing repairs or inspections, the connection part 101 must be left in the ceiling and the ventilation fan body 102 must be directly removed, which makes the work difficult.
This has the disadvantage that the airtightness between the ventilation fan 02 and the duct connection part 101 deteriorates, and the performance of the ventilation fan itself is also impaired. The present invention improves these conventional drawbacks,
Embodiments of the present invention will be described below with reference to FIGS. 2 and 3.

FIG. 2 is a side sectional view of one embodiment of the present invention, and FIG. 3 is an exploded perspective view of the main parts thereof. In these figures, 1 is a box-shaped ventilation fan body with a side intake port 2 on one side and a duct connection port 3 on the other side.
A blower 4 is built in so that air is sucked in through the side intake port 2 and discharged through the duct connection port 3. 5 is a sound absorbing material provided on the inner wall of the ventilation fan body 1 between the side intake port 2 of the ventilation fan body 1 and the blower 4, and 6 has a side discharge port 7 on one side that matches the side intake port 2 of the ventilation fan body 1. It is a box-shaped ventilation box with a lower suction port 8 formed at the bottom, and a sound absorbing material 9 is provided on the inner wall. A hook 10 is provided below the side intake port 2 of the ventilation fan main body 1, screw holes 11 are provided in the upper and lower parts of the side intake port 2 of the ventilation fan main body 1, and the ventilation box 6 is provided with a hook 10. An engagement hole 12 is provided below the side outlet 7 of the ventilation box 6 so that the hook 10 engages with the hook 10, and an engagement hole 12 is provided in the upper and lower parts of the side outlet 7 of the ventilation box 6 to connect the hook 10 to the ventilation fan main body 1. A through hole 13 is provided at a position that matches the provided screw hole 11. Reference numeral 14 denotes a decorative grill provided to cover the lower surface suction port 8 of the ventilation box 6, and a spring piece 15
It is detachably attached to the ventilation box 6. 16 is a reinforcing frame provided on the upper part of the ceiling board 17, and 18 is a fan bolt for fixing the ventilation fan main body 1 and the ventilation box 6.

During construction, the ventilation fan main body 1 configured as described above is attached to the reinforcing frame 16 in the ceiling, and the ventilation fan main body 1 is positioned to the side of the ventilation opening formed in the ceiling board 17. Next, the engagement hole 12 of the ventilation box 6 was hooked onto the hook 10 of the ventilation fan body 1, the side intake port 2 of the ventilation fan body 1 was aligned with the side outlet 7 of the ventilation box 6, and the fan bolt 18 was formed on the ventilation box 6. After the ventilation box 6 is connected to the ventilation fan main body 1 by passing through the through hole 13 and screwing into the screw hole 11 of the ventilation fan main body 1, the decorative grill 14 is attached to the ventilation box 6 by a spring piece 15.

When the ventilation fan installed in this manner is operated, the air sucked into the ventilation box 6 by the blower 4 through the decorative grille 14 enters the side intake port 2 of the ventilation fan body 1 through the side outlet 7 of the ventilation box 6. The air is discharged from the duct connection port 3 by the blower 4 .

When performing the next inspection or repair, the decorative grill 1
4, loosen the fan bolts 18, remove the ventilation box 6 from the ventilation fan body 1, and take out the ventilation box 6 from the ceiling to perform inspection work.Inspection and repair can be performed with the ventilation fan body 1 fixed in the ceiling. Do the following.

In this way, there is no need to move the ventilation fan main body 1 during inspection or repair, so there is no need to remove or connect the power cord part required for movement, and furthermore, the ventilation fan main body 1 can be left fixed. Therefore, there is no fear that the airtightness around the duct connection port 3 will be impaired. Also, ventilation fan body 1
Since the noise emitted from the ventilation box 6 is configured to pass once through the ventilation box 6, the noise is reduced by the sound absorbing material 9 provided in the ventilation box.

In the embodiment shown in FIGS. 2 and 3 above, the size and shape of the ventilation box 6 are made almost equal to the ventilation fan main body 1, but these may affect the performance of the ventilation fan main body 1, and the inspection and It can be arbitrarily selected in consideration of workability such as repair. Further, the shape of the lower air intake port 8 can be freely selected according to the interior design.

As described above, according to the present invention, when inspecting or repairing the ventilation fan main body, the ventilation fan main body can be inspected and repaired while it is fixed in the ceiling without removing it from the duct. airtightness is not compromised. Further, effects such as the ability to freely select the size and shape of the opening provided in the ceiling plate according to the design of the room can be obtained.
